Round 2 12wbt - 2 Weeks In & How Are We Going?

Hi everyone!!! Well how have your first 2 weeks been going for this round of 12WBT?

I have been busy busy busy, with lots of gigs and trying to get in as much training as possible. I've done a few runs, and been seeing my trainer, Tennille, for my toning and muscle building sessions! I have been sore as - either in the legs or the arms - for most of the last 14 days!

Unfortunately though, sometimes the body just gives in, and for me, this has been the last few days. I woke on Sunday morning with a really sore throat, and by the time I got home Sunday afternoon, I was ready to park myself on the couch for the next few days - and that is what I did. I turned up to training this morning, hoping for some last chance training before weigh-in tomorrow, but was promptly sent out of the gym!! It is a new thing to get your head around, that you have gotten so used to actually getting up an exercising, that when you are virtually forced to sit on your butt and do nothing, you feel guilty about it! I couldn't resist some 'comfort food' while feeling unwell, so yesterday while keeping my fluids up with lots of water, my sore throat enjoyed some icy cold lemonade! I also enjoyed some yummy vegemite sandwiches made for me by the other half! Thank you!!! In between I had some healthy chicken & veg soup & lots of vitamin c filled mandarins & kiwi fruit! As I am so close to my goal weight, I will be ok if there isn't too much of a change this week on the scales, as I certainly have not been able to push it in my training.

How has your week been? Are you getting used to the changes in your nutrition and physical activity levels?
